What god do Imperials worship?

After the apotheosis of Tiber Septim, Imperials began to spread belief in the Nine Divines, incorporating worship of the Empire’s god-hero Talos.

Which divine do Imperials worship?

The Imperial Cult of the Nine Divines, sometimes referred to as the Citizenship Cult, is a loose alliance of the Great Faiths who worship the common orthodoxy of the Nine (or Eight-and-One) Divines under the auspices of the Empire.

What are the Stormcloaks fighting for?

Stormcloaks. The Stormcloak movement was initiated by Jarl Ulfric Stormcloak of Eastmarch after the Markarth Incident, and aims to remove the Imperial Legion from Skyrim and turn the province into an independent kingdom.

Who is god in The Elder Scrolls?

Arkay is the god of birth, death, and burials, and as such is widely worshipped across not just Skyrim but all of Tamriel.

Who do the High Elves worship?

The Altmeri – or High Elves – are a magically talented race prone to thoughts of racial superiority, which ends up forming the Aldmeri Dominion and the malicious Thalmor. They only worship the Aedra, known in their language as ‘ancestor spirits’, and they despise all forms of Daedric worship.

What do the Imperials fight for?

The Imperial Legion is the military arm of the Empire, which, prior to its Great War with the Aldmeri Dominion, ruled over most of Tamriel. The Legion is attempting to quell the rebellion led by Ulfric Stormcloak, with the goal of restoring the peace and keeping Skyrim in the Empire.

Can you become High King in Skyrim?

In Skyrim, the High King or Queen typically inherits the throne by birth and rules for life or until abdication. In the event that no direct heir to the throne exists, High Kings are selected by a moot, or vote, conducted by the current Jarls of each of the nine Holds.

What God do Imperials worship in Skyrim?

Imperials think of Akatosh as the protector of the Empire and shield against foreign enemies. Patron of authorities, historians, and legitimate birth. Akatosh demands absolute submission to his will, which he rewards with eternal stability and permanence.

What god do Bretons worship?

In Daggerfall, Bretons also worshiped a god named Ebonarm, one of the Yokudan divinities. The fictional ‘Breton’ race is influenced by the real life Celtic Bretons who are natives of the Armoric Peninsula in Northwestern France.

What god do Argonians worship?

Contents. Except for a few of the most assimilated, Argonians worship neither Aedra nor Daedra. They do not have “religion” as it is known elsewhere in Tamriel. They are known to venerate the Hist Trees of Black Marsh, but they do not appear to have prayers, priests, or temples.
